Waiting for Morning Book Review



Waiting for Morning by Karen Kingsbury was a I chose because I am a fan of Kingsbury's writing. This book is so incredibly sad and realistic about a car accident and tragedy. The story focuses on Hannah Ryan as parts of her family are killed and her anger and hatred toward God and the world consume her. Kingsbury writes so well that you could feel the anger this woman felt and the sadness and hurt her living daughter goes through.

This book is definitely about forgiveness and how incredibly difficult is it sometimes to live a life as a Christian when everyone goes wrong.

I would recommend this book to anyone who likes Kingsbury and who doesn't want a light read, this is not a happy book to read. It has a great message but at times I really didn't want to read it because it is heart wrenching.
